方法/步骤分步阅读
1.磁盘阵列是现今非常流行的一种磁盘管理技术,通常称为独立磁盘冗余阵列,也简称为磁盘阵列。按现在流行的等级可分为raid0 raid1 raid2 raid3 raid4 raid5 raid10,等级并不高低之分只是方式不一样而已
2.raid0(条带)是多块磁盘组合为raid0后,数据将被分割并分别存储在每块磁盘上,所以能最大提升存储性能与使用空间,但无法冗余,至少需要两块磁盘。
它的空间是最小磁盘空间的两倍,读写速度都比较快
缺点:两块磁盘中有一块损坏导致整个文件无法读取
3.raid1(镜像)多块磁盘组合成raid1后,数据被同时复制到每块磁盘中,至少需要两块磁盘,因为是镜像模式的,只要有一块磁盘可用就可以正常运行,它的是空间是总利用磁盘空间大小的一半,写入速度会慢一些,但读取速度很快
4.raid2(位校验条带式)多磁盘组合后数据以位为单位同步式分别存储在不同的磁盘上,并采用海明码对数据进行校验与恢复,如果有数据要写入到raid2,至少需要三块磁盘,其中有一块磁盘是单独存储校验码的磁盘,如果其它两块盘有一块损坏,raid2会对其它没有损坏的磁盘进行计算,并恢复已经损坏的磁盘,从而实现恢复功能,对大数据量的读写性能很高,但不适合少量数据的读写,raid3与raid2一样只是raid3是以字节的方式存储数据,raid4与raid2也一样,raid4是以数据块形式存储数据
5.raid5(数据块级别条带式),虽然raid5也是以数据块条带式方式进行数据的存储,但与raid4不同的是raid5的海明码可以存储到不同的磁盘,至少三块磁盘,空间利用率为(n-1)/n
6.raid10(镜像与条带存储),它并不是一种新的方式,而是一种组合方式是raid1与raid0的组合,它有两种结构一种是raid1+0,另外一种是raid0+1,如果是raid1+0它至少需要四块磁盘,把四块磁盘分组组成两个raid1,然后再把两个raid1组合成一个raid0,但这种方式磁盘利用率比较低,只有50%
7.另外还有一种磁盘管理技术是jobd,它的作用是针对比较大的单个文件进行存储的,如日志文件,当第一块磁盘使用满之后 ,它可以在这块磁盘上叠加磁盘,但相对不好的一点是一旦其中一块损坏,数据将无法进行恢复,因为存储的始终是一个大数据文件